- Waimakariri River: A stunning river offering breathtaking scenery and a variety of outdoor activities. Perfect for picnics, walking tracks, and enjoying the natural beauty of the Canterbury region.
- Cave Stream Scenic Reserve: A unique reserve featuring a fascinating cave system that you can explore. The stream flows through a dramatic limestone cave, providing an adventurous experience for keen adventurers.
- Kura Tawhiti Scenic Reserve: Known for its impressive limestone formations and stunning landscapes, this reserve is ideal for rock climbing and photography, showcasing the beauty of the Southern Alps.
